PSU is overkill, you can get away with less power even for SLI. $299 for a 1KW PSU is a lot. Try to get a something like 650W or 750W for less than $100 after rebates. I'd recommend a Intel X38 board and CF 4850 or get a 4870. You should also wait for R700 to be released and check that out before you build. I'm not taking any chances with my PSU, I think a cheap 650 watt PSU pushing 2 260GTXs, an OCed Quad core & 2 Raptors might be a stretch. Besides, I found the one I want for $240.

I can't spend $1k on video cards, so the R700 won't work for me. I chose the 260GTX over the 4870 because of the higher memory, overclocking ability, better drivers, & they're the same price now.
